Global Handheld Blower Market Overview

The handheld blower market size has shown remarkable growth in recent years, and its value was estimated at USD 1.41 billion in 2021. The industry's positive trajectory is projected to continue, with the market expected to reach USD 2.31 billion by 2030. This growth indicates a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.6% during the forecast period from 2022 to 2030.

The handheld blower market is a thriving segment within the outdoor power equipment industry, catering to the growing demand for efficient and convenient tools for outdoor cleaning and maintenance tasks. Handheld blowers are portable devices used to blow away debris, leaves, grass clippings, and other lightweight materials from outdoor spaces.

Handheld Blower Industry Developments

April 2019:

EGO, the top-rated brand in cordless outdoor power equipment, made waves in the handheld blower industry by introducing its latest innovation - the 615 CFM Blower. This new handheld blower is regarded as one of the most advanced in the marketplace, setting higher standards for performance and efficiency. With a powerful airflow rating of 615 cubic feet per minute (CFM), this handheld blower offers users a high-performance solution for outdoor cleaning tasks.

December 2021:

FILPOW Ltd., a prominent player in the outdoor power equipment market, made a significant announcement regarding the launch of its latest product - the B8 Pro Cordless Leaf Blower. This cordless leaf blower has received certification from SGS, the world's leading testing, inspection, and certification company. The certification attests to the blower's quality, safety, and compliance with industry standards. FILPOW's B8 Pro Cordless Leaf Blower aims to offer users a reliable and efficient tool for clearing leaves and debris without the constraints of cords or cables.

August 2021:

San Mateo, a notable entity in the environmental and sustainability domain, took a proactive step to address noise pollution concerns related to leaf blowers. The company launched an electric leaf blower rebate program, encouraging users to switch from noisy gas-powered blowers to quieter electric alternatives. By offering rebates or incentives, San Mateo aims to promote the adoption of electric leaf blowers, which produce lower noise levels and have a reduced impact on the environment.
